• 博客园logo
  • 会员
  • 众包
  • 新闻
  • 博问
  • 闪存
  • 赞助商
  • HarmonyOS
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录

wchenfeng

  • 博客园
  • 联系
  • 订阅
  • 管理

公告

View Post

Java数据类型的自动转换

 

 System.out.println()语句,其功能是输出括号中的表达式的值然后换行。

public class app3_1
{
    public static void main(String[] args)
    {
        int a=155;
        float b=21.0f;//单精度后面常常加F或者f;
        System.out.println("a="+a+",b="+b);
        System.out.println("a/b="+(a/b));
    }
}

当两个数中有一个为浮点数时,其运算结果会自动转换成浮点数。

当表达式中变量的类型不通顺,Java会自动将较小的表示范围转换为较大的表示范围,再做运算。

posted on 2022-04-12 20:03  王陈锋  阅读(89)  评论(0)    收藏  举报

刷新页面返回顶部
 
博客园  ©  2004-2025
浙公网安备 33010602011771号 浙ICP备2021040463号-3